Who runs City of Kenedy?
City of Kenedy (PWSID TX1280002) is a local government-owned community water system, regulated by the TX state drinking water program.
How many people does City of Kenedy serve?
City of Kenedy reports serving 6,454 people through 2,910 service connections in Karnes County, Texas.
Where does City of Kenedy get its water?
EPA SDWIS lists this system's primary water source as groundwater.
